tiger-lib 1.18.0

Library used by the tools ck3-tiger, vic3-tiger, and imperator-tiger. This library holds the bulk of the code for them. It can be built either for ck3-tiger with the feature ck3, or for vic3-tiger with the feature vic3, or for imperator-tiger with the feature imperator, but not both at the same time.
